Repost via @lovely.yoga.life ・・・ El Diwali o la Fiesta de las Luces (también llamado Divali o en sánscrito, Deepavali o Deepawali) es la gran fiesta de India: la entrada del nuevo año hindú. . La Reina de las Fiestas es Lakshmí, esposa del dios Vishnú, diosa que simboliza la buena suerte, la belleza y quien otorga la prosperidad y la riqueza. También, el popular dios Ganesha es especialmente venerado en estos días. . Dentro de la cultura hindú, esta celebración representa uno de los días más importantes del año, y por esa razón se trata de pasar el día en compañía de la familia para llevar a cabo actividades tradicionales. Algunas de las tradiciones más importantes son, limpiar las casas completamente de manera que cuando se enciendan las lámparas, el dios Lakshmi vea digno el entrar en sus casas y les ofrezca su bendición con suerte durante el año venidero. . Se suele instalar un altar en algún lugar importante de las casa donde esté presente una imagen de Lakshmi a la que se le ofrecen flores, incienso y monedas mientras se repite el mantra Om Shri Maha Lakshmyai Namaha. . Al anochecer, se abren todas las ventanas y puertas de las casas, y en cada una de ellas se realiza un ofrecimiento de Luz con una lámpara de aceite o una vela, repitiendo el mismo mantra, para que Lakshmi se instale en los hogares el resto del año. También se lanzan barcos de papel o lamparillas encendidas a los ríos sagrados, cuanto más lejos vayan, mayor será la felicidad en el año venidero. A la salida del sol se realiza el ritual de lavarse la cabeza, que tiene el mismo efecto que bañarse en el sagrado río Ganges. .
